Monitoring for Availability



To make sure a smooth distribution process for your dumpster rental, it's important to analyze the ease of access of the drop-off area. Beginning by measuring the width of the entry and any entrances to guarantee they're large sufficient for the dumpster truck to go through. Check for any low-hanging branches, cables, or obstacles that might obstruct the delivery course. Clear away any kind of particles, vehicles, or other items that may restrain the dumpster's positioning.

In addition, think about the surface where the dumpster will certainly be left. Make certain it's level and firm enough to sustain the weight of the dumpster. Prevent soft ground that could cause the dumpster to sink or turn.

Informing Next-door Neighbors and Neighborhood Authorities



When scheduling a dumpster rental shipment, it's important to inform your neighbors and neighborhood authorities regarding the upcoming drop-off. Informing your neighbors beforehand can aid protect against any kind of prospective concerns or worries they might have pertaining to the positioning of the dumpster, especially if it may momentarily impact auto parking or accessibility to their residential or commercial properties.



In addition, reaching out to neighborhood authorities, such as your city or home owner's organization, can make certain that you're complying with any regulations or guidelines associated with dumpster placement on your property.

Alerting neighbors can likewise cultivate excellent relationships within the area and show consideration for their requirements. It's an easy politeness that can go a long way in preserving positive communications with those who live near you.

Neighborhood authorities may have specific guidelines concerning where dumpsters can be placed, how much time they can continue to be there, and what sorts of materials are enabled to be gotten rid of, so it's important to be knowledgeable about and follow these guidelines to prevent any type of potential penalties or fines.
